Scholarships and Fellowships to be Awarded to More Than 135 Students

The College of Geosciences will hold its annual Scholarship & Fellowship Banquet this Friday, October 26th, at The Brazos Cotton Exchange in downtown Bryan. Over 135 scholarships and fellowships will be awarded to both graduate and undergraduate students. The College will be awarding $75,000 total, in addition to varying amounts from the Department of Atmospheric Sciences, the Department of Geology & Geophysics, the Department of Geography, and the Department of Oceanography.

The guest speaker for the evening will be Kellam Colquitt, Chief Operating Officer of Richardson based Reef Exploration Inc. Colquitt graduated from the Texas A&M College of Geosciences in 1970 with a degree in Geology. Colquitt is a member of the American Association of Petroleum Geologists, the Houston and Dallas Petroleum Clubs, and the Houston Geological Society.
